IMPORTANT NOTES
The information contained within this guide is accurate at time of placement of order.
The electronics rack is supplied with 10 metres cables as standard, which allowing for cable drops, leaves 9 metres between rack & other system parts.
However, please note that the effective distance between parts may be reduced even further to avoid other obstructions or if cables are routed via cable
trays.
STS only recommend the use of orbitally welded VCR fittings for all gas line installations from source to gasbox. Only fit correctly rated regulators. It is also
recommended a wall-mounted isolation valve, high flow valve & non return valve be fitted in each gas line. Failure to provide this equipment may result in
unnecessary delays in the commissioning of the system.
In order to check the foreline for leaks, STS recommend fitting an isolation valve on the chamber pump.
A helium leak detector or similar equipment must be made available for STSs appointed engineer to use to commission the equipment. Failure to provide
this equipment may result in unnecessary delays in the commissioning of the system.
All facilities points of connection to have flexibility designed in to allow for vibration due to a seismic event.
STS recommend a noise survey assessment as part of the installation. STS also recommend positioning the pumps in the grey area away from the
operators point of use, if possible.
If this system is to be electrically installed by non STS personnel, it must be installed in line with the requirements of the latest issue of STS quality
documents: Q000130, Q000131, Q000135 & electrical drawing ED322778, using a suitable electrical installation tester. These documents are available from
STS by mailing the address below. If STS engineers are to electrically install this system they must be notified if an appropriate electrical tester is available
to prevent any delay.
The supply cable to this tool must be sized in accordance with local electrical rules/regulations & is the responsibility of the customer to ensure it is suitably
rated prior to installation.
A suitably rated mains circuit breaker should be installed up stream of the main breaker on the STS supplied electronics rack.
An input from a fire system can be linked in to the STS EMO circuit if required.

PROCESS GASES REQUIREMENTS
NOTES
Process performance can be influenced by pressure variation in certain gases (particularly C
4
F
8
, SiCl
4
& BCl
3
). In order to minimise this effect, thought
should be given to their storage conditions (for instance, store indoors to maintain a stable temperature).
Should Argon not be required as a process gas, it must still be made available for de-chucking when using an electrostatic clamp.

TURBO INFORMATION
CAUTION WHEN USING THE TURBO
If you are involved in removing the turbo, it is essential that the splinter guard is re-installed correctly (see page 24 of the operating instructions).
When the turbo is in use the basic flange can become so hot (>80
o
C, >176
o
F) that it represents a burn hazard. While this flange is protected by an
insulated collar (which should not be removed) the rest of the body should also be treated with care to avoid burns.
